Japanese 54 bore Matchlock, 33.5 inch barrel with script reading ‘23’ made by Daishido Jinzaemon (Dai-shi-do , Jin-za-e-mon) the tube decorated with a flaming pearl and dragons, fitted into Akagashi, red oak stock, together 50 calibre bullet mould and a fitted case with foam inner, leather backed with leather handle and strap, made of pitch pine.

This matchlock was used and shot in competitions until recently, the breach plug has been re-threaded and replaced in 2015. The touch hole and pan were mended and laser welded in 2015.
The maker was probably from Settsu City, Osaka although the gun has some features relating to the town of Kunitomo which is located in the central part of Honshu Island quite near Lake Biwa.
The Mon is: Sagari-fuji mon - usually used by the Fujiwara clan, The wisteria itself has a very long lifespan and an especially high rate of propagation, traits that the mon's users hoped to receive themselves!
On the barrel is: A flaming pearl or 'Hoju' the precious jewel of life and mystery This represents wisdom/wealth/luck and the eternal pursuit of it. This along with the Dragons were added on possibly for sale to the western market
The script in the wooden barrel channel - highly likely production number of gun, with the same number written inside the barrel. This is the number 23 of a lot order by one daimyo (clan leader) for his troops.
Under Urabe's gunsmith list there is a Daishido Jinzaemon in Settsu Province who signed a gun with the date 安永4年, (1776) which (assuming this is the same smith) tells us that he was making guns before and/or after 1776, so this can be used as an approximate date.’
